What the Filing Says About Sterling Employee Savings Plan

Sterling Employee Savings Plan is a 401(k) retirement plan sponsored by Sterling Corporation, headquartered in Massachusetts. As of the 2022 Form 5500 filing, the plan reports $15M in total end-of-year assets and covers 163 participants across the Transportation & Warehousing industry. The sponsor's EIN on file with the U.S. Department of Labor is 042890273, and the plan has been effective since 1981-04-01. Its filing status is currently FILING RECEIVED.

Year over year, total assets moved from $11M at the beginning of 2022 to $15M at year-end — a gain of 34.6%. Net assets (after liabilities) closed the year at $15M, with reported net income of $-722,738 driven by investment returns, contributions received, and benefit payments during the period. These figures reflect what the plan administrator certified on Schedule H or Schedule I of the Form 5500 annual return and can be compared against 2 prior plan-year filings from the same sponsor shown below.
